Hi all,

Just out of curiosity; when you add your negative keywords for your campaigns, do you add them all within the Campaign Settings of each Campaign (and) or (or) withing the Ad Groups list of keywords with a (-) in front of each keyword?

If the negative keywords can apply to every ad group add them at the campaign level. If they would block one or more positive keywords in ANY ad group in that campaign they have to be added at the ad group level.

Giving some advance thought to how you organize your account can save time by allowing you to use more negatives at the campaign level.

Just a thought in passing, but you should be a little cautious with negative keywords if you are appearing on the content network, as you can miss out on some quite good sites, particularly if your negative keywords are quite generic words...

I do recommend that advertisers run search and content in separate campaigns so that results can be tracked separately.
